Position Summary: Vertiv is focusing on overhauling the technology landscape of the Service business and requires an IT Technical Project Manager / Business Analyst to drive requirement gathering, align on priorities, plan activities and follow up with implementation to make sure business requirements are met and the adopted technologies provide the expected value. This role will work closely with business stakeholders, and it will be responsible for capturing requirements, translating the requirement to technical documentation, aligning with developers on efforts and monitoring execution of changes. This role requires analytical skills, understanding of IT systems, integrations, and service processes. The activities in scope are related to the implementation of additional functionalities, enhancements, re-engineering of software applications, and related integrations, used to sustain and improve Vertiv Service business. Key Responsibilities Requirements Gathering & Analysis, Documentation Facilitate discussions with stakeholders, document and validate business requirements Translate business needs into functional and non-functional requirements for developers. Act as the bridge between business stakeholders and IT/development teams. Create effective presentations to clarify deliverables and plans Solution Design, and Quality Assurance Contribute to the technical solutioning discussions with the developers Define and lead the delivery plan to implement the technical solution Testing & Quality Assurance Overview of the change management process to rollout changes Define and support functional, regression, and UAT (User Acceptance Testing) cycles. Track defects, issues, and resolutions to ensure system quality.
